From f3155ea180a9dfcfad9f8d356e5d334fe8ccf48f Mon Sep 17 00:00:00 2001 From: syuilo Date: Sun, 25 Nov 2018 13:36:40 +0900 Subject: [MFM] Add center syntax Resolve #1775 --- src/mfm/html.ts |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src/mfm/html.ts') diff --git a/src/mfm/html.ts b/src/mfm/html.ts index d45cc13af4..8b63d8f824 100644 --- a/src/mfm/html.ts +++ b/src/mfm/html.ts @@ -45,6 +45,12 @@ export default (tokens: Node[], mentionedRemoteUsers: INote['mentionedRemoteUser return pre; }, + center(token) { + const el = doc.createElement('div'); + dive(token.children).forEach(child => el.appendChild(child)); + return el; + }, + emoji(token) { return doc.createTextNode(token.props.emoji ? token.props.emoji : `:${token.props.name}:`); }, -- cgit v1.2.3-freya